An Overview of West Tahoe Park
West Tahoe Park, situated within the city of Sacramento, California, is a vibrant neighborhood with a rich heritage and diverse community. The neighborhood is mostly residential, with single-family homes and apartment complexes. It is defined not only by its geographical location but also by its unique neighborhoods, including Tahoe Park East, Tahoe Park South, Tahoe Terrace, and the central area of West Tahoe Park.
The neighborhood offers a dense suburban feel, with most residents owning their homes. It is surrounded by a large chain of coffee shops, parks, and local businesses, making it an excellent neighborhood for families, young professionals, and retirees. Its location within Sacramento County means that it enjoys easy access to the amenities of the wider Sacramento area.
West Tahoe Park boasts a population of approximately 1,668 individuals who are known for their liberal tendencies. The neighborhood is characterized by a community that values diversity, inclusivity, and high quality of life.

The West Tahoe Park Neighborhood Statistics
What is the average cost of a home in West Tahoe Park?
The median sale price of homes in West Tahoe Park is about $479,000, but the range varies significantly, with properties listed from $449K to $765K. This cost is relatively affordable compared to many other Californian neighborhoods, making it an attractive option for potential homebuyers.
What about rental prices?
The average rental price in West Tahoe Park is approximately $2,912, making it lower in price than 59.2% of California neighborhoods.
What is the population of West Tahoe Park?
The neighborhood is home to about 1,668 people. It's a tight-knit community where many residents know each other, fostering a sense of unity and community spirit.
